Mac 端 VSCode Flutter 快捷键大全

Mac 端 VSCode Flutter 快捷键大全


通用快捷键

基础导航

快捷键 功能
Cmd + P 快速打开文件
Cmd + Shift + P 打开命令面板
Cmd + T 快速查找项目中的符号
Cmd + B 显示/隐藏侧边栏
Cmd + Shift + E 聚焦到资源管理器
Cmd + \ 水平分屏

通用代码操作

快捷键 功能
Cmd + Z 撤销上一步操作
Cmd + Shift + Z 恢复撤销操作
Cmd + C / Cmd + V 复制/粘贴
Cmd + Shift + D 打开运行和调试模式
Option + Shift + ↑ / ↓ 上下复制代码块
Cmd + / 添加/取消注释
Cmd + D 选中下一个相同内容
Cmd + F2 重命名所有选中变量

代码结构

快捷键 功能
Cmd + Option + [ / ] 折叠/展开代码块
Cmd + Shift + [ / ] 折叠/展开所有代码块
Cmd + Click 跳转到定义
Cmd + Shift + O 显示文件中的符号
Cmd + Option + F 查找并替换

Flutter 专属快捷键

Widget 操作

快捷键 功能
Cmd + . 快速修复

Flutter 调试

快捷键 功能
F5 启动调试
Shift + F5 停止调试
Cmd + Shift + F5 热重载

Dart 文件导航

快捷键 功能
Cmd + F 在当前文件中搜索
Cmd + Shift + F 在整个项目中搜索
Cmd + Option + ← / → 前进/后退导航位置
Cmd + Click 跳转到变量/方法定义

终端与控制台快捷键

快捷键 功能
Ctrl + ~ 打开/关闭终端
Cmd + K 清空终端输出
Cmd + Shift + Y 打开/关闭调试控制台

推荐插件

  • Flutter:Flutter 官方插件,支持热重载、代码片段和 Dart 语言特性。
  • Dart:提供 Dart 语言的语法高亮、代码提示等功能。
  • Error Lens:将错误和警告直接显示在代码旁边。
  • Code Runner:快速运行选定代码片段(支持 Dart)。
  • Todo Tree :跟踪代码中的 TODOFIXME 注释。
  • Flutter Stylizer:自动优化 Dart 文件中的导入顺序。

自定义快捷键

  1. 打开命令面板:Cmd + Shift + P
  2. 输入 Keyboard Shortcuts,选择 Preferences: Open Keyboard Shortcuts
  3. 找到需要修改的快捷键,点击右侧的铅笔图标,设置你喜欢的快捷键。
  4. 官网详细介绍

记录下这些快捷键并在开发中实践,你的效率将大幅提升! 🎉🎉🎉

相关推荐
蓉妹妹13 小时前
vscode的各种使用场景
ide·vscode·编辑器
刘某某.14 小时前
macOS 终端美化完整教程(Ghostty + Zsh + Starship Catppuccin Powerline)
macos
咦呀14 小时前
macOS 上 SVN 报错 "SQLite 编译为 X.XX,运行时为 X.XX" 的完整解决方案
macos
jiejiejiejie_16 小时前
Flutter for OpenHarmony 视频播放与本地身份验证萌系实战总结
flutter·华为·音视频·harmonyos
liulian091616 小时前
【Flutter for OpenHarmony 第三方库】Flutter for OpenHarmony 第三方社交登录功能适配与实现指南
flutter·华为·学习方法·harmonyos
lilili也16 小时前
Git、VScode、GitLab
git·vscode·gitlab
liulian091617 小时前
【Flutter for OpenHarmony第三方库】Flutter for OpenHarmony 骨架屏实现与用户加载体验优化指南
flutter·华为·学习方法·harmonyos
SilentSamsara17 小时前
Python 基本语法:变量、数据类型与 print 的秘密
vscode·python·pycharm
Lanren的编程日记17 小时前
Flutter 鸿蒙应用无障碍功能实战:语义化标签+屏幕阅读器+键盘导航,全方位提升应用可用性
flutter·华为·计算机外设·harmonyos
上弦月-编程17 小时前
C语言位运算:从入门到精通
运维·c语言·开发语言·vscode·算法·leetcode·极限编程